Tenth Judicial Circuit — Judge Mark F. Carpanini only. Practices change without notice; the court's own published text controls. Procedural information only; not legal advice.
• Continuance Procedure: Motions for continuance are disfavored and will be granted only upon good cause shown. Successive continuances are highly disfavored. Lack of due diligence is not grounds for granting a continuance. Except for good cause shown, the motion must be signed by the party requesting the continuance, as required by Florida Rule of General Practice and Judicial Administration 2.545(e).
